We are looking for an Infrastructure Expert Support Engineer to join our mission of protecting the digital world. The Infrastructure support engineer is part of a dedicated team of experts responsible for advanced troubleshooting of hyper‑converged storage and computer clusters. The role provides an opportunity to practice technical skills with Linux, network, storage, cloud, virtualization and container technologies and directly influence the evolution of our products. Responsibilities Troubleshoot and resolve various technical incidents for customers and partners. Build and maintain strong relationships with customers and partners. Collaborate with Engineering (Development, QA, Data Center Operations, etc.) and Business (Professional Services, Product Management, etc.) departments to efficiently resolve complex technical customer issues. Train and mentor junior team members by sharing technical expertise and best communication practices. Participate in developing documentation, knowledge base, and technical articles on Acronis products. Serve as a technical expert in cloud and hybrid datacenter solutions, including software‑defined high‑performance storage, compute clusters, disaster recovery infrastructure, and managing complex environments during failover and failback operations. Qualifications 3+ years of experience in an infrastructure support engineer role. Additional languages are an advantage (Spanish, French, Portuguese, German). Technical Expertise Linux OS (Advanced): Strong hands‑on experience with administration and troubleshooting across multiple Linux distributions. Red Hat Certified System Administrator (RHCSA) or equivalent is considered a baseline. Networking Experience with traffic inspection, routing, and bandwidth analysis. Ability to set up and manage DHCP, DNS, L2TP/IPSec, and OpenVPN. Experience with high‑availability configurations. Private Cloud / Virtualization Experience working with enterprise‑level virtualization or container solutions such as VMware ESXi, Microsoft Hyper‑V, KVM, Virtuozzo. Soft Skills & Work Approach Fluent English (written and verbal). Strong communication skills and a customer‑first mindset.
